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H] disas/libvixl: Really suppress gcc 4.6.3 sign-compare warnings

Commit 8acc216b956 attempted to silence some sign-compare
warnings in libvixl by adding -Wno-sign-compare to the CFLAGS
for the relevant objects. Unfortunately it was ineffective
because it was placed before $(QEMU_CFLAGS), so the -Wall in
the general flags overrode -Wno-sign-compare rather than
vice-versa. Reorder the flags so the warning suppression works.

disas/libvixl/Makefile.objs |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/disas/libvixl/Makefile.objs b/disas/libvixl/Makefile.objs
index d1e801a..bbe7695 100644
--- a/disas/libvixl/Makefile.objs
+++ b/disas/libvixl/Makefile.objs
@@ -6,6 +6,6 @@ libvixl_OBJS = vixl/utils.o \
# The -Wno-sign-compare is needed only for gcc 4.6, which complains about
# some signed-unsigned equality comparisons which later gcc versions do not.
-$(addprefix $(obj)/,$(libvixl_OBJS)): QEMU_CFLAGS := -I$(SRC_PATH)/disas/libvixl -Wno-sign-compare $(QEMU_CFLAGS)
+$(addprefix $(obj)/,$(libvixl_OBJS)): QEMU_CFLAGS := -I$(SRC_PATH)/disas/libvixl $(QEMU_CFLAGS) -Wno-sign-compare
common-obj-$(CONFIG_ARM_A64_DIS) += $(libvixl_OBJS)
